Something running in the background could be interferring with Impusle connecting. This can be caused by extra 'security' apps, like SpyBot, AdAware and the like. Even some anti-virus applications can have their own 'spybot' functions, and Firewall settings. Check your system (SysTray) for any of these 'watcher' type programs and try to turn them off, then launch Impulse, and watch the bottom left of the window, when it is done connecting, you won't see any text there,

1. -Click on Start, Run, then type "regedit.exe" and click OK 2. -on windows XP 32bits, Go to H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Stardock\Drengin.net\Galciv2 3. -here you should find a String value named "Language" with "English" as Data 4. -if it's blank fill it with "English" 5. -if it doesn't exist, right click then select New, String Value and name it "Language"

Stardock Central lets you Archive a game on an internet-connected PC, and Restore to a non-internet PC, but SDC doesn't have the latest updates. Our Impulse Developers are at this moment working on allowing Impulse to do this also. Another issue with moving the game files, is the games have System Registry Keys that get entered during install. Moving the files won't place thsoe Keys in the Registry.
